The Minnedosa Jets were a Intermediate hockey team playing in the Big Six Intermediate Hockey League (BSIHL).
Season-by-Season Record[]
Season | League | GP | W | L | T | GF | GA | Points | Finish | Playoffs |
1954-55 | BSIHL | 24 | 7 | 16 | 1 | na | na | 15 | 5th | DNQ |
1955-56 | BSIHL | 30 | 18 | 10 | 2 | 183 | 123 | 38 | 1st | Won League |
1955-56 | MAHA Playoffs | 6 | 4 | 1 | 1 | 25 | 15 | - | - | Won Manitoba |
1955-56 | CAHA Playoffs | 10 | 6 | 3 | 1 | 47 | 40 | - | - | Lost W-Semi Final |
1956-57 a | BSIHL | 18 | 11 | 6 | 1 | na | na | 23 | 1st | - |
1956-57 | MAHA Playoffs | 5 | 1 | 4 | 0 | 16 | 24 | - | - | Lost 'AA' Semi Final |
note a: League wiped out player scoring stats the December 20th against Carman, officially Minnedosa won the game with a score of 0-0. Actually the score was 5-3.
